Easy to install fall protection where it matters most! Join us for this one-hour course on safety railing systems. Steel made and sustainable, this course will illustrate the benefits of fall prevention measures with these safety systems centered on ease of installation and project integration. Modular, ballasted and non-penetrating safety railing systems promote circularity and are LEED credit eligible. Highlighting the importance of a fully comprehensive product that does not rely on ad hoc integration, participants will investigate the value of comprehensive, integral safety rail systems. Throughout this course, participants will deepen their understanding of the hazards associated with roof worksites, OSHA protocols and maintenance industry safety. We will close with an evaluation of the benefits of safety railing systems for constructing the built environment.
- Classify OSHA compliant safety railing systems with an assessment of passive v. active fall protection to determine the demand, site specific applications and work site safety benefits of these integral systems.
- Identify the advantages of the ballasted safety rail systems including the sustainability, cost-effectiveness and fall protection they offer.
- Appraise safety railing systems regarding third party testing, OSHA compliance and sustainable materials that inform product development and design.
- Survey applicable case studies related to safety railing systems that demonstrate how they contribute to safe environments for construction and maintenance industries.
